A last-ditch attempt to find a solution for the ongoing Marine Stewardship Council certificate sharing dispute between two groups of Alaska salmon processors has failed, according to Stefanie Moreland of Trident Seafoods. 

"The parties were unable to reach a certificate sharing agreement through mediation," she said.

Mediation between the Alaska Salmon Processors Association (ASPA), the current owners of the MSC Alaska salmon fishery certificate, and a group of some of the state's largest processors led by Trident Seafoods began Monday in Seattle.

The Trident-led group was hoping ASPA would let it share the certificate, which would have allowed the group the ability to market this year's catch using the MSC eco-label.
